COMMERCIAL DESCRIPTION
Cask; Status uncertain.
A pitch black stout with hints of blackcurrant.

Cask at NWAF, 2012. Black pour with a light tan head. Coffee, chocolate and licorice aroma. Heavy malt presence. Licorice and coffee flavour. Bitter-sweet dry roast finish. Tasty.

50cl Bottle Conditioned.6%. A month or so past best before date. Poured very flat, no head. Very dark coloured with a dry roast nose. Full of fruity flavour with roasted coffee and some chocolate notes and a strong hoppy finish. Quite dry. A nice, if different, take on the style.

A Mes rate: Cask at the Crown Inn, Stockport. Glorious black looks with a thick creamy tan head. Roasty yet hoppy nose with some berries. More of the same in the flavour with plenty of milk chocolate and ground coffee. Hoppy finish gives it a nice balance. Interesting stout.

Gravity fed half pint at the London Drinker Beer Festival, black with a bubbly beige head. A strong blackcurrant presence in the lightly roasted and hopped aroma. The blackcurrant is mroe subtle in the flavour, which is quite sweet. Hop and roasted presence ismore notable in the finish. A very different stout, but it works.
